> In them I describe my cooling mod where I recored with a Modine
louvered 5 row (125 tubes) radiator and faned it with a flex-a-lite
Black Magic 2800 cfm / 13.9 amp single sucker fan (16")
{(www.flex-a-lite.com/auto.htm)}. We haven't had any hot days in So.
Cal., but my digital thermometer based tests and a few calculations
suggest that my car will idle at 180 in 95-100 deg weather. The fan
cost ~$180, and the recore ~400 (including splitting my right tank in
two to eliminate any baffle problems.
>
> In some recently run tests, I confirmed my suspission that idle
speed has a big effect on temperature. At 800 rpm and 70 deg air temp,
the return temperature to the engine was measured at 114.4 deg. At
1200, it was 145.8!! The thermostat fully opens at about 157 deg at
800 rpm (don't know what it is at 1200). When you think about it, the
engine is dooing about 50% more work at 1200 rpm and will thus
generate roughly 50% more heat.
